What is Internet of Things (IoT)?

The Internet of Things refers to a network of interconnected devices, sensors, and objects that can collect and exchange data. IoT Devices enable the integration of physical objects into the digital world, creating opportunities for automation, data analysis, and real-time decision-making. AI plays a crucial role in processing the vast amount of data generated by IoT devices.
